Intégrer un Menu Bootstrap dans un Thème WordPress

Découvrez comment ajouter un menu Bootstrap à votre thème WordPress et le rendre personnalisable via l'arrière-site.

Détails de la leçon

Description de la leçon

Dans cette leçon, nous allons apprendre à intégrer une barre de navigation Bootstrap dans un thème WordPress. Nous commencerons par récupérer un modèle de navbar Bootstrap, que nous allons simplifier en supprimant les éléments superflus comme les drop-down menus et les listes inutiles.

Ensuite, nous passerons à la configuration de l'arrière-site WordPress pour activer les options de menu. Nous ajouterons des fonctions PHP spécifiques dans functions.php de notre thème pour déclarer notre menu principal.

Enfin, nous parlerons de l'importance des classes Bootstrap pour le style de notre menu et comment les intégrer correctement dans notre thème. Pour gérer des éléments plus complexes comme les sous-menus, nous découvrirons l'utilité de wp-bootstrap-navwalker, un script disponible sur GitHub.

En suivant ce tutoriel, vous serez capable de personnaliser et de configurer efficacement des menus Bootstrap dans vos thèmes WordPress.

Objectifs de cette leçon

À la fin de cette vidéo, les participants seront capables de :
1. Intégrer un menu Bootstrap dans un thème WordPress.
2. Configurer l'arrière-site WordPress pour gérer les menus.
3. Utiliser wp-bootstrap-navwalker pour des menus avancés.

Prérequis pour cette leçon

Les prérequis nécessaires pour suivre cette vidéo incluent :
1. Connaissances de base en WordPress.
2. Expérience avec le framework Bootstrap.
3. Notions de PHP et de développement web.

Métiers concernés

Les métiers susceptibles de tirer parti de cette vidéo comprennent :
1. Développeur web.
2. Intégrateur web.
3. Concepteur de thèmes WordPress.
4. Freelance en développement web.

Alternatives et ressources

Des alternatives pourraient inclure :
1. Utiliser un autre framework CSS comme Foundation.
2. Intégrer une bibliothèque tierce de menus pour WordPress.
3. Créer un menu personnalisé en utilisant uniquement des outils WordPress natifs sans Bootstrap.

Questions & Réponses

Intégrer wp-bootstrap-navwalker permet de gérer efficacement les sous-menus et les sous-catégories dans une navigation Bootstrap, alignant le style et la fonctionnalité avec les standards de WordPress.
Dans functions.php, il faut ajouter la fonction register_nav_menus() et définir le menu avec un identifiant spécifique, comme 'primaire', pour lier la navigation à l'arrière-site WordPress.
Utiliser Bootstrap pour une barre de navigation dans WordPress offre une compatibilité mobile intégrée, une stylisation facile avec des classes CSS prédéfinies et une personnalisation avancée via des scripts et des composants Bootstrap.